question
CNA blood agar is used to ...
answer
SPECIFICALLY GROW gram positive organisms such as staphylococci, streptococci and enterococci

question
colistin and nalidixic acid are ANTIBIOTICS that act as SELECTIVE AGENTS AGAINST ...
answer
gram negative organisms
question
Therefore, CNA blood agar is a ...
answer
SELECTIVE media
-ONLY ALLOWS growth of GRAM POSITIVE species

question
Colistin:
answer
-can insert into the outer membrane of the gram negative bacterial cell wall
-the insertion of the colistin into the outer membrane DISRUPTS the INTEGRITY of the OUTER MEMBRANE, which can lead to bacterial cell lysis

question
Nalidixic acid:
answer
-disrupts bacterial enzymes involved in DNA replication, thereby INHIBITING DNA SYNTHESIS
-gram negative bacteria are MORE SENSITIVE to nalidixic acid than gram positive bacteria

question
the SHEEP BLOOD in the columbia CNA agar also makes the media ...
answer
DIFFERENTIAL
-different bacteria will show DIFFERENT red blood cell HEMOLYSIS PATTERNS when grown on agar that contains sheep's blood
